#a0499e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a0499e is composed of 62.7% red, 28.6%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.4% magenta, 1.3%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 301.4 degrees, a saturation of 37.3% and a lightness of 45.7%. #a0499e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#41003d.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

● #a0499e color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#a0499e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a0499e has RGB values of R:160, G:73,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.01,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10504606.

Shades and Tints of #a0499e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c050c is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a0499e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c6d7c is the less saturated color, while #e801e2 is the most saturated one.
